Teenager charged following 'glassing', NSW

A teenager has been charged after allegedly assaulting two other teenagers at an unauthorised beach party near Lake Macquarie last night, NSW Police say.

Just after 9pm yesterday today, police attended a party at Second Creek, at Redhead Beach, following reports of an assault.

Upon arrival officers from Lake Macquarie Local Area Command were approached by two 17-year-old males, one of whom had sustained a laceration to his face and neck.

Initial investigations suggest another teen approached the pair while holding a glass bottle.

He then allegedly struck one of the 17-year-olds on the back of the head, before slashing the second teenager across the face with the broken bottle.

Both injured teenagers were treated by NSW Ambulance Paramedics, before being taken to Belmont Hospital.

Police arrested a third male, also aged 17, and he was taken to Belmont Police Station.

He was charged with assault occasioning actual bodily harm and reckless wounding and was granted conditional bail to appear at Children’s Court on Monday 16 May 2016.
